Windows中ssh连接Ubuntu中ssh服务器

本文详细介绍了在Ubuntu上安装和配置SSH服务的过程,包括更新仓库、安装OpenSSH服务器、设置开机自启动、配置防火墙、以及Windows环境下Git安装和SSH连接的步骤。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

ubuntu安装ssh
1.首先更新仓库,并安装ssh
sudo apt-get update

sudo apt install openssh-server
2.开启ssh服务
sudo service ssh start
或者
sudo service ssh restart

# 停止ssh服务
sudo service ssh stop

3.设置ssh服务开机自启动
# 开机自启动
sudo systemctl enable ssh
#查看ssh服务状态
sudo systemctl status sshd

4.修改ssh的配置文件sshd_config,默认路径为/etc/ssh/ssd_config ,修改port,ListenAddress,PermitRootLogin
sudo gedit /etc/ssh/sshd_config

5.开启防火墙:
sudo ufw enable
6.ssh远程连接默认使用的是22号端口,要让防火墙允许ssh服务通过防火墙(如果改成了其他端口,一样的操作)
sudo ufw allow ssh
sudo ufw allow 22/tcp
7.修改后重启ssh服务,使其配置生效:
sudo systemctl restart ssh

windown7 下安装openssh
最近需要安装git,在本地建仓后,远程SSH服务,需要安装openssh
安装流程:
1.下载setupssh-8.0p1-2.exe;下载地址:https://www.mls-software.com/opensshd.html0

2.打开[运行]->输入cmd->打开命令行窗口->输入ssh->按回车
3.启动服务: net start opensshd
停止服务: net stop opensshd

查看版本:ssh -V

4.连接ubuntu中的ssh,,执行

ssh edu@192.168.34.58

### 如何从 Windows 通过 SSH 连接Ubuntu 为了实现从 WindowsUbuntu 的安全 Shell (SSH) 访问,可以遵循如下指南: #### 安装并配置 OpenSSH Server 在 Ubuntu 上 确保目标 Ubuntu 系统上安装有 OpenSSH server。这可以通过更新包列表并安装 openssh-server 来完成。 ```bash sudo apt update && sudo apt install openssh-server -y ``` 验证服务状态以确认其正在运行[^1]。 ```bash systemctl status ssh ``` #### 配置防火墙允许 SSH 流量 如果启用了 UFW(Uncomplicated Firewall),则需开放默认的 SSH 端口 22。 ```bash sudo ufw allow 22/tcp ``` 再次检查 UFW 状态来确保更改已生效。 #### 使用 PuTTY 或 Windows 自带 SSH Client 进行连接 对于 Windows 用户来说,有两种主要方式来进行 SSH 连接:一种是利用图形界面工具如 PuTTY;另一种则是直接使用命令提示符中的 `ssh` 命令,因为自 Windows 10 版本 1809 起微软已经内置了 OpenSSH client 功能。 ##### 方法一:使用 PuTTY 下载并安装最新版本的 PuTTY 应用程序。启动应用程序后,在 "Host Name (or IP address)" 字段输入远程服务器地址,并设置端口号为 22,默认情况下即可保持不变。点击 “Open” 开始会话。 ##### 方法二:使用 Windows 内置 SSH Client 打开 PowerShell 或者 CMD 提示符窗口,键入下面这条指令替换其中 `<username>` `<hostname_or_ip_address>` 成实际用户名以及主机名/IP 地址。 ```powershell ssh <username>@<hostname_or_ip_address> ``` 首次建立连接时可能会被询问是否继续连接,这是因为本地机器尚未保存远端主机的身份认证信息。选择 yes 并按 Enter 键继续操作。 成功登录之后就可以像平常一样管理 Linux 文件系统或是执行其他任务了。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

向前走,一直走

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值